The Adobe ColdFusion Flaw: A Race Against Time

One thing that immediately stands out is CVE-2026-48282, a path traversal vulnerability in Adobe ColdFusion with a perfect CVSS score of 10.0. What many people don’t realize is that this isn’t just a theoretical risk—it was exploited within hours of its disclosure. Joomla’s Unauthenticated Nightmare

Next up is CVE-2026-56290 in Joomla’s Page Builder, another CVSS 10.0 flaw. What this really suggests is that unauthenticated file uploads are still a blind spot for many developers. The exploit allows attackers to upload arbitrary files, leading to remote code execution. From my perspective, this is a classic case of convenience over security. Joomla’s popularity makes it a prime target, and the fact that exploitation efforts were recorded as early as June 2026 shows how quickly these flaws can be weaponized. What’s worse? Attackers can plant malicious files in unexpected directories, making detection a nightmare.

Langflow’s Cross-Tenant Breach: A New Frontier

Now, let’s talk about CVE-2026-55255 in Langflow, a vulnerability with a CVSS score of 6.1. At first glance, it might seem less severe than the others, but here’s where it gets interesting: this flaw allows authenticated attackers to bypass authorization and execute flows belonging to other users. What makes this particularly fascinating is the broader implication—AI orchestration platforms like Langflow are treasure troves of credentials. Sysdig’s analysis reveals that attackers exploited this flaw to steal LLM provider keys and AWS keys. In my opinion, this is a wake-up call for the AI industry. As AI becomes more integrated into critical systems, these platforms will become even juicier targets.

The Zero-Day Phantom in JoomShaper

Finally, there’s CVE-2026-48908 in JoomShaper’s SP Page Builder, another CVSS 10.0 flaw. This one was exploited as a zero-day to upload PHP files, leading to the creation of Super User accounts. What many people don’t realize is that zero-day exploits are the digital equivalent of a stealth bomber—they strike without warning. The fact that this flaw was used to deliver web shells highlights the sophistication of modern attackers.
